Output f66070eaf2d59552e931a7c4ca6e1811c33e644276f587f7b0d9ea95b70e517c:2

value
8233841
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ad83b407ecdcb9bdf6a11d4a32746bf2c7fbbe6e OP_EQUAL
address
MPicuX3WXCrWeygp3vwQvWMkr79iiC7fnX
transaction
f66070eaf2d59552e931a7c4ca6e1811c33e644276f587f7b0d9ea95b70e517c
spent
true